effarant: article récent avantage joomla !!

Réduire
X
  • Filtrer
  • Heure
  • Afficher
Tout effacer
nouveaux messages

  • #16
    J'ai pas mis le nom du CMS en clair pour ne pas avoir un procès en diffamation
    tu ne risque rien vu le "cms" en question. On ne peut pas t attaquer pour avoir dit une verité ..

    si il y a un truc que wp fait mieux que joomla mais c est du a son heritage: la gestion de commentaires en natif, le multisite aussi.

    roland_d_alsace likes this.
    Mon site en cours de construction avec de nouvelles catégories de documents...
    https://informaticien51.fr

    Commentaire


    • #17
      Bonjour,

      Pourquoi avoir créer la bibliothèque oEmbed-API :https://github.com/swissspidy/oEmbed-API pour ensuite l'intégrer directement dans wp et mettre le dépôt en archive sur github ? C'est contraire aux règles de composer

      c'est ça leur vision de l'open-source chez wp ?

      le dépôt wp sur github sert juste à faire de la figuration vu il est juste synchronisé tous les quart d'heure avec un vieux dépôt SVN
      Dernière édition par xillibit à 10/06/2019, 13h25

      Commentaire


      • #18
        Envoyé par xillibit Voir le message
        Pourquoi avoir créer la bibliothèque oEmbed-API :https://github.com/swissspidy/oEmbed-API pour ensuite l'intégrer directement dans wp et mettre le dépôt en archive sur github ? C'est contraire aux règles de composer
        Bonjour,

        Oembed est un standard ouvert ( https://oembed.com/ ) et wp est sous licence GPL (comme Joomla). Il y a de nombreux exemples similaires de librairies (y compris intégré à joomla). Je n'ai pas vu que leur intégration était contraire aux règles. Si tu as plus de détails ou explications, tu peux l'indiquer ?

        Oembed date de plus de 10 ans, de 2008 pour être précis (Au passage, on prend un coup de vieux!). La solution sous wordpress permet d'intégrer un contenu "embed" en collant simplement l'url dans l'éditeur de texte. Par exemple en collant l'url de youtube, il est remplacé automatiquement par le lecteur video de youtube. Pour répondre à ta question, la décision d'intégrer nativement dans ce cms fut certainement guidé par la sécurité et le suivi nécessaire, le contenu importé est filtré, la fonction "discovery" est désactivée.

        A l'origine, ce standard fut créé par plusieurs personnes dont Leah Culver qui en a écrit les spécifications, Cal Henderson ( qui est co-fondateur de Slack) et deux autres auteurs. D'autres contributeurs comme Pascal Birchler (Swissspidy) et Gary Pendergast ont réalisé cette intégration dans wordpress.

        Sous Joomla (ainsi que d'autres cms comme Drupal et Spip), ce n'est pas natif mais différentes extensions proposent l'équivalence comme OSEmbed de Joomlashack : https://extensions.joomla.org/extension/osembed/ La dernière mise à jour de OSEmbed est récente (publiée depuis 4 jours), c'est indiqué sur la JED ainsi que sur le compte github : https://github.com/OSTraining/OSEmbed

        Sur le plan technique, je ne vois pas trop l'intérêt d'alourdir inutilement le cms, il y a d'autres possibilités d'intégrations bien plus passionnantes même si ce standard reste encore utilisé. Je n'aime pas non plus les iframes générées surtout que la réglementation européenne (RGPD) oblige à bloquer avant d'obtenir le consentement (à cause notamment de certains cookies). Si on privilégie la sécurité (CSP), cela se complique. C'est également le cas pour l'intégration sur smarphone (problème d'affichage responsive, de développement d'une api joomla pour application).

        Sur le plan humain, il y a de bonnes volonté et cela continue encore sur de nombreux autres projets. Il ne faut pas voir forcément des sociétés mais des contributeurs (d'où le fait de nommer ces personnes). Je regrette cependant certaines dérives, y compris autour des extensions Joomla.

        Sur le comparatif joomla vs wordpress (sujet principal de cette discussion), il y a aura toujours des choix sur l'un comme pour l'autre des cms. Cela ne m'a jamais dérangé de travailler sur un cms autre que Joomla que ce soit dans le développement ou la réalisation de template et d'aborder d'autres techniques par passion ou par nécessité tout simplement. C'est fort utile d'avoir une vision assez large, on comprends mieux certains décisions y compris dans le développement de Joomla 4.
        Joomla User Group (JUG) Lille : https://www.facebook.com/groups/JUGLille/

        Commentaire


        • #19
          Code:
          Sur le plan technique, je ne vois pas trop l'intérêt d'alourdir inutilement le cms
          Salut daneel,
          C'est vrai. Mais pour intégrer quelque chose (librairies ou autre) à Joomla, il faut surtout que ce soit une fonction de base du cms et des cms au sens large.
          Les dev Joomla pensent aussi comme ça. On marches à l'économie de code. C'est aussi pour ça que certaines idées ne sont pas retenues.

          Et c'est un comparatif technique, pas commercial. Moi ce que j'y gagnes, c'est de voir toutes les différences. Je sait pourquoi je suis sous Joomla et je suis ici.
          Expliquer ce qui les différencies. C'est la meilleure aide au choix possible.

          Il y a des choses très simple qui manques à Wordpress. Regardes les cms en général, et tu verras que beaucoup propose un réglage et une configuration d'un serveur smtp. L'envoi de mails est une fonction de base d'un cms. Ne serais ce que pour recevoir les notifications du système.
          Ce n'est pas une critique, mais la réalité.

          Il a aussi certains avantages comme le multisite. Pour un site de news, diffuser son contenu via plusieurs domaines est une fonctionnalité de base, d'ou cette fonctionnalité présente dans wordpress. Sous Joomla, il faut passer par une extension.

          Et le coeur de cible n'est pas le même du tout. Pour ça, il suffit de regarder dans la doc officielle. On parles de propriétaire de blogs et de sites de news...

          Et ma comparaison n'as rien d'anodine quand tu compares le fonctionnement de Wordpress et Windows.

          C'est totalement différent de Joomla.
          Dernière édition par lefabdu51 à 13/06/2019, 07h29
          Mon site en cours de construction avec de nouvelles catégories de documents...
          https://informaticien51.fr

          Commentaire


          • #20
            Pourquoi avoir créer la bibliothèque oEmbed-API :https://github.com/swissspidy/oEmbed-API pour ensuite l'intégrer directement dans wp et mettre le dépôt en archive sur github ? C'est contraire aux règles de composer
            Composer a des règles bizarre s'il interdit de réutiliser son propre code GPL.
            De plus, le code étant libre n'importe qui peut contribuer directement via github, sans avoir à coder pour wordpress. Ce sont deux projets différents. D'ou la création de la bibliothèque.
            Mon site en cours de construction avec de nouvelles catégories de documents...
            https://informaticien51.fr

            Commentaire


            • #21
              la je travailles sur la création de contenu.
              Et les différences sont flagrantes.

              Pour changer d'éditeur sous Wordpress, tu doit te taper du PHP et ajouter un nouveau plugin.
              Sous Joomla, tu installes ton plugin et ensuite tu cliques dans l'interface d'administration pour le configurer et l'utiliser par défaut..

              Rien n'est simple sous Wordpress.
              J'ai écrit 10 fois plus de lignes de code pour le configurer alors que sous Joomla, ce n 'est que du clic souris.

              Tu peux insérer un module joomla dans un article , mais pas un widget dans un post Wordpress.

              Entre les shortcodes, les fonctions (fichier functions.php), les widgets que tu doit déclarer avec du code PHP, les modifs de theme à faire en PHP, je me demandes vraiment comment les gens allergiques au code font pour le personnaliser.
              Mon site en cours de construction avec de nouvelles catégories de documents...
              https://informaticien51.fr

              Commentaire


              • #22
                la il s averes que mon comparatif est vraiment long...j espere le finir et vous le présenter pour fin aout.
                woluweb likes this.
                Mon site en cours de construction avec de nouvelles catégories de documents...
                https://informaticien51.fr

                Commentaire


                • #23
                  Envoyé par lefabdu51 Voir le message
                  la il s averes que mon comparatif est vraiment long...j espere le finir et vous le présenter pour fin aout.
                  Oui, je t'encourage aussi dans cette entreprise intéressante et utile pour voir les atouts et faiblesses de chacun

                  Encore bravo et merci à l'avance
                  Cordialement, Bruno28
                  Joomla! 3.9.10 - www.bp2i.fr

                  Commentaire


                  • #24
                    salut
                    très court article mais je suis globalement d'accord sur ce que je voudrai faire passer ici
                    https://www.firecoders.com/joomla-vs-wordpress

                    Commentaire

                    Annonce

                    Réduire
                    1 sur 2 < >

                    C'est [Réglé] et on n'en parle plus ?

                    A quoi ça sert ?
                    La mention [Réglé] permet aux visiteurs d'identifier rapidement les messages qui ont trouvé une solution.

                    Merci donc d'utiliser cette fonctionnalité afin de faciliter la navigation et la recherche d'informations de tous sur le forum.

                    Si vous deviez oublier de porter cette mention, nous nous permettrons de le faire à votre place... mais seulement une fois
                    Comment ajouter la mention [Réglé] à votre discussion ?
                    1 - Aller sur votre discussion et éditer votre premier message :


                    2 - Cliquer sur la liste déroulante Préfixe.

                    3 - Choisir le préfixe [Réglé].


                    4 - Et voilà… votre discussion est désormais identifiée comme réglée.

                    2 sur 2 < >

                    Assistance au forum - Outil de publication d'infos de votre site

                    Compatibilité: PHP 4.1,PHP4, 5, 6DEV MySQL 3.2 - 5.5 MySQLi from 4.1 ( @ >=PHP 4.4.9)

                    Support Version de Joomla! : | J!3.0 | J!2.5.xx | J!1.7.xx | J!1.6.xx | J1.5.xx | J!1.0.xx |

                    Version française (FR) D'autres versions sont disponibles depuis la version originale de FPA

                    UTILISER À VOS PROPRES RISQUES :
                    L'exactitude et l'exhaustivité de ce script ainsi que la documentation ne sont pas garanties et aucune responsabilité ne sera acceptée pour tout dommage, questions ou confusion provoquée par l'utilisation de ce script.

                    Problèmes connus :
                    FPA n'est actuellement pas compatible avec des sites Joomla qui ont eu leur fichier configuration.php déplacé en dehors du répertoire public_html.

                    Installation :

                    1. Téléchargez l'archive souhaitée : http://afuj.github.io/FPA/

                    Archive zip : https://github.com/AFUJ/FPA/zipball/master

                    2. Décompressez le fichier de package téléchargé sur votre propre ordinateur (à l'aide de WinZip ou d'un outil de décompression natif).

                    3. Lisez le fichier LISEZMOI inclus pour toutes les notes de versions spécifiques.

                    4. LIRE le fichier de documentation inclus pour obtenir des instructions d'utilisation détaillées.

                    5. Téléchargez le script fpa-fr.php à la racine de votre site Joomla!. C'est l'endroit que vous avez installé Joomla et ce n'est pas la racine principale de votre serveur. Voir les exemples ci-dessous.

                    6. Exécutez le script via votre navigateur en tapant: http:// www. votresite .com/ fpa-fr.php
                    et remplacer www. votresite .com par votre nom de domaine


                    Exemples:
                    Joomla! est installé dans votre répertoire web et vous avez installé la version française du fichier FPA:
                    Télécharger le script fpa-fr.php dans: /public_html/
                    Pour executer le script: http://www..com/fpa-fr.php

                    Joomla! est installé dans un sous-répertoire nommé "cms" et vous avez installé la version française du fichier FPA:
                    Télécharger le script fpa-fr.php dans: /public_html/cms/
                    Pour executer le script: http://www..com/cms/fpa-fr.php

                    En raison de la nature très sensible de l'information affichée par le script FPA, il doit être retiré immédiatement du serveur après son utilisation.

                    Pour supprimer le script de votre site, utilisez le lien de script de suppression fourni en haut de la page du script. Si le lien de suppression échoue pour supprimer le script, utilisez votre programme FTP pour le supprimer manuellement ou changer le nom une fois que le script a généré les données du site et le message publié sur le forum. Si le script est toujours présent sur le site, il peut être utilisé pour recueillir suffisamment d'informations pour pirater votre site. Le retrait du script empêche des étrangers de l'utiliser pour jeter un oeil à la façon dont votre site est structuré et de détecter les défauts qui peuvent être utilisé à vos dépends.
                    Voir plus
                    Voir moins

                    Partenaire de l'association

                    Réduire

                    Hébergeur Web PlanetHoster
                    Travaille ...
                    X